Description Developed over the last two years, this work is in three parts, the third of which will only be completed late in 1999 and will feature a rare solo danced by Mathilde Monnier herself.
Like Pour Antigone, Les Liux de La features live music, in this case written by Heiner Goebbels (whose Black on White was such a hit in the last Festival) and played by guitarist Alexandre Meyer. Further Information Translates as "Places Over There". The first of two works programmed in this year's Festival to showcase the development of Mathilde Monnier's work over a period of years.
